Alocal LGBTIQ+ support group is set to benefit from participating in a national day of donation on Thursday.

Limestone Coast Connect will be taking part in GiveOUT Day, inspired by the success of the US concept.

Motivated by the lack of funding support for LGBTIQ+ community groups across the country, GiveOUT Day Australia is a national day of giving to LGBTIQ+ communities.

Limestone Coast Connect chair Patrick Smith said everyone has the right to feel included, accepted, supported and safe.

“But in Australia one in two LGBTIQ+ people still keep their identity a secret due to fear of discrimination in the workplace, social settings or at home,” he said.

“At least one in 10 Australians identify as LGBTIQ+, yet only five cents in every 100 dollars of all philanthropic funding flows through to the LGBTIQ+ community.

“GiveOUT is hosting GiveOUT Day to address this lack of funding, and is calling upon community members and allies alike to join them in providing support for LGBTIQ+ community projects.”

Mr Smith said this year the group was raising funds to go toward community education in the Limestone Coast region.

“The funds will assist in the delivery of community sessions about LGBTIQA+ people, their needs and barriers to inclusion in regional and rural South East South Australia,” he said.

“Through our own research we are still seeing there is a general misunderstanding of basic LGBTIQA+ terms and concepts which then in turn leads to discrimination, harassment and bullying.

“While access to digital resources will go some way to improve the current situation, localised in-person face-to-face presentations and conversations will personalise the experience and show visibility to the community across all seven LGAs.

“At Limestone Coast Connect we aim to social connection, advocacy and community education and without any funding we are heavily reliant on volunteer time, resources and emotional labour.”

“A small contribution will go a long way with the Fay Fuller Foundation doubling SA-based donations,” he said.
